蚍 is pronounced pí in Mandarin Chinese. It means large ant.
蚍蜉是一种小虫子。
pí fú shì yī zhǒng xiǎo chóng zi
A 'pifu' is a type of small insect.
这样做是蚍蜉撼树。
zhè yàng zuò shì pí fú hàn shù
Doing this is a futile effort, like an ant trying to shake a tree.
我看到一只大蚍蜉。
wǒ kàn dào yī zhī dà pí fú
I saw a large ant.
